Description



The Chiltern is a four-bedroom detached home that manages to feel both timelessly characterful and thoroughly modern in equal measure. Beautifully finished, this is a home that truly deserves to be seen in person.


From the moment you step inside, The Chiltern announces itself as something special. The dual-aspect living room is an immediate highlight, a wonderfully light and generous space measuring, warmed by a central wood burner set within a reclaimed brick fireplace with a timber surround. It is the kind of room that is genuinely inviting in every season: cool and bright in summer with bi-fold doors thrown open to the garden, and cosy and atmospheric in winter with the fire glowing. This is a room you will want to spend time in, and it sets the tone for everything that follows.


The open-plan kitchen and dining area continues to impress, with an L-shaped kitchen, and French doors leading to a generous rear garden, a wonderful outdoor space for families and entertainers alike. A utility room sits conveniently alongside, and a dedicated study makes working from home not merely possible but genuinely comfortable.


Upstairs, The Chiltern reveals another of its most distinctive features a master bedroom characterised by charming sloping ceilings and dual-aspect windows that flood the room with natural light, creating a truly unique and atmospheric retreat. With fitted wardrobes and a private en suite shower room, it is a bedroom that feels far removed from the ordinary. Bedroom two is equally well-served, also featuring fitted wardrobes and its own en suite, ideal for guests or older children. Bedrooms three and four both benefit from fitted wardrobes too, and are served by a well-appointed family bathroom, completing a first floor where every bedroom has been genuinely thought through.


The Chiltern also includes a detached garage and parking for two cars and is our show home at Church View, Bramford

Bramford, recorded in the Domesday Book as ‘Brunfort’ or ‘Branfort’, provides the ultimate setting for Church View. This beautiful collection of 2, 3, 4 & 5-bedroom homes is ideally located close to the countryside but with excellent transport links for that sought-after lifestyle balance.

Why choose a new home at Church View?

Beautifully Designed

Each home at Church View has been crafted with care—featuring modern layouts, high-quality finishes, and timeless architecture. Whether you’re seeking a spacious family home or a low-maintenance bungalow, there’s a property to suit every stage of life.

Built for Efficiency & Comfort

Every home is built with sustainability in mind. Expect high levels of insulation, double glazing, and an EPC rating of B or higher. As standard, homes include air-source heat pumps and underfloor heating, helping reduce running costs and environmental impact.

Quality You Can Trust

Hopkins Homes is known for exceptional craftsmanship and customer care. All homes at Church View come with a 10-year NHBC warranty, offering complete peace of mind.

Green Space & Nature on Your Doorstep

Church View has been thoughtfully landscaped to foster both community and biodiversity. Enjoy generous public open spaces, natural planting, and wildlife-friendly features like bat boxes and hedgehog highways—all designed to create a calm, leafy environment to come home to.

Well Connected for Modern Living

Ideally located just outside Ipswich, Church View is perfectly placed for both rural living and commuter convenience. With easy access to the A12 and A14 and direct trains from Ipswich to London Liverpool Street in just over an hour, you’re always connected.

Everyday Essentials, Close to Home

The village of Bramford offers all the essentials within easy reach—from a Co‑op, local shops and a welcoming pub, to takeaways, sports fields, and active community groups. It’s a place where you can settle in and feel at home.

Building for a Healthy Life

Church View has been recognised with the highly regarded Building for a Healthy Life accreditation, Homes England’s benchmark for exceptional design and placemaking. The award celebrates developments that create attractive, sustainable neighbourhoods where people and nature can thrive, with a strong focus on healthy streets, green spaces, connectivity and a true sense of community.
